I swapped a 77 idiot light harness to my 74 guages. I can tell you for sure that it was a pain. I have the diagrams and notes somewhere, but the bottom line is that they both have the same amount of wires. Where they go in the plug is different, and the plugs are different.
It was cool, but looking back, I would have rather put in aftermarket guages.

It's easier to swap out the main harness in your dash, for one with Gauges, than it is to re-wire your Idiot light harness to accept gauges.
And if you re-wire the Idiot light harness wrong, it can be a fire hazzard. As one member here found out. Search for ammeter shunts.
Aftermarket is by far the easiest way to go.
